Standard, Deep, Move-Out & Post-Construction Cleaning in Freehold
Not every clean is the same job. Here is the honest difference, from cleaners who do this every day:
- Standard clean — your regular upkeep: kitchen surfaces, appliance fronts, stovetop and sink, bathrooms fully wiped and disinfected, floors swept and mopped, dusting, vacuuming, and trash taken out. Best on a home that is already maintained.
- Deep clean — everything in a standard clean, plus the detail work: baseboards, window sills, blinds dusted, hard-water buildup on faucets, shower doors and grout scrubbed, ceiling fans, inside the microwave, and (on request) inside the fridge and oven. This is what a first-time or long-overdue clean needs.
- Move-out clean — the same deep-clean detail on an empty home, aimed at getting your deposit back: empty cabinets, inside appliances, window tracks, and baseboards.
- Post-construction clean — after a remodel or new build, when fine drywall dust coats everything. A careful wall-to-floor process, priced for the extra work.

How House Cleaning Is Priced in Freehold
Honest pricing depends on the size and condition of your home, not a flat guess. Bigger homes and deeper cleans take longer, and a well-maintained place on a recurring plan costs less per visit than a first-time deep clean. You get a clear estimate up front.
What makes a clean take longer (and cost more): a home that has never had a professional clean, pets — especially on carpet, small children, and heavy clutter. We factor these in honestly instead of lowballing and then upcharging on the day.
Rough time on site: a standard clean usually runs 2 to 3½ hours; a deep or move-out clean 4½ to 6½ hours; post-construction longer. That way you can plan your day.
Supplies: our pros bring their own professional-grade supplies and equipment. Prefer a specific product for a certain surface? Leave it out and we will use it.
What's Included in Each Clean: Basic vs. Deep vs. Move-Out
Here is exactly what each type of clean covers, so you can pick the right one:
| Task | Basic | Deep | Move In/Out |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sweep, vacuum & mop |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e countertops & backsplash |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e down all surfaces, tables & stands |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Vacuum carpets & area rugs |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e appliance exteriors |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e fridge exterior |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ean stovetop |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ean microwave |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ean sinks |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ean toilets |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ean bathtubs / showers |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ean mirrors |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Empty & wipe trash cans | ✓ |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e handles & light switches |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Dust window sills / ledges |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e baseboards |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Dust / wipe vents |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Dust / wipe ceiling fans |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Clean cabinets / drawers (exterior) | — | ✓ | ✓ |
| Wipe cabinets & drawers (interior) | — | — | ✓ |
| Clean fridge / freezer (interior) | — | — | ✓ |
| Clean oven (interior) | — | — | ✓ |
| Wipe down door frames | — | — | ✓ |
A move-out clean is the most thorough — it adds the inside of cabinets, the fridge, the oven, and door frames on top of a deep clean.
